1. Chateau d'Esclans Whispering Angel Rose 2020
With grapes and wines from Château d’Esclans and local growers, one of the world’s greatest rosé is produced. Only the finest grapes and growers can bring out the fresh red berry fruit characteristics with a floral nose. This dry rosé has a smooth and round finish.

5. 2020 Elicio Rosé
A blend of 80% Grenache and 20% Syrah, the 2020 Elicio Rosé is strongly on the fruity side with a tarty hint that is embodied by fresh berries. As one of the most highly rated wines, its fragrance of creamy flowers and fresh red raspberries will dance around your nose.

9. Chateau Ste. Michelle Columbia Valley Rosé
The Chateau Ste. Michelle Columbia Valley Rosé is filled with tropical fruits like citrus, melon, berry and watermelon. This wine is more on the dry side crafted from 98% Syrah and 2% Merlot. Best paired with food that has strong flavors like aged cheese and cured meats.

11. La Vieille Ferme Rosé
At 13.5% alcohol by volume, the La Vieille Ferme Rosé is a light wine with a mid-range profile. Enjoy a smooth glide of citrus, floral and red fruit notes that complete its blend of Syrah, Grenache and Cinsault grapes.
